Failed exports in the Ledgerbark API may be retried up to five times with exponential backoff starting at 30 seconds. Retries reuse the original export_id, so duplicate artifacts are never created. The retry endpoint requires the same scopes as export creation. Authenticate each retry request with the bearer token below.

bearer token for tawig-bahif: eyJhbGciOiJIUzI1NiIsInR5cCI6IkpXVCJ9.eyJzdWIiOiIo-yiO33jvEIn0.T9qLInSAqhTN

Leadership Review Briefing — Winding Down the Corvet Line

Quick one for the finance team ahead of Thursday's review: we're recommending retirement of the Corvet accessory line by year-end. Volumes have slid three straight quarters, and margins are now thinner than our storage costs justify. Plan is a final production run, a clearance push through the Delmore channel, then warranty support for 18 months. Write-down on remaining tooling is modest and already modelled. Nothing dramatic, just housekeeping. One piece of this stays confidential.

board note of tadup-tajog: Headcount on the Oliiel team goes from 31 to 88 by the end of February. Gross margin on Oliiel came in at 62 percent against a plan of 29 percent.

## Approvals: Profile Store Sharding

Hey — if you're touching the Wrenfold user-profile store, know that any shard-count or shard-key change needs formal approval first. Resharding is expensive and we've been burned before (ask anyone about the Midgate incident). Write up your plan, post it in the approvals queue, and wait for the green light. The approver is listed below.

named custodian: Brivan Eliath Quenox Frador

Welcome aboard. This is the weekly release note for FeedCheck, our podcast feed validator at Larkwhistle Media. Version 2.4 adds stricter enclosure-size checks and better handling of malformed pubDate fields. Nothing in this build changes the CLI flags, so existing scripts on the Penhallow servers should run unmodified. Staging validation passed overnight; the full regression suite finished clean this morning. If you see failures, flag them in the release channel before Thursday. The trace token for this build follows.

build token for fajep-yajof: htk9_7d88c0238